It’s not only you; whenever I toss a concept of using Leadfeeder to recognize site visitors, I face this concern– How does Leadfeeder understand who is visiting the website?
This might initially sound like magic, but it is nothing more than an intelligent mix of website analytics, tracking cookies, and artificial intelligence.
Before going ahead, I want first to clarify that Leadfeeder does not exactly recognize “unidentified” individuals who visited your site; it recognizes the business that visit your site. Based on that, it supplies you with the contact details of key people related to the company.

Leadfeeder is a business that provides a list building tool for companies. The business’s primary product is a lead capture and management system that helps organizations to identify and track potential clients who visit their website.
Is Leadfeeder free?
Using Leadfeeder, organizations can see which companies are visiting their site, what pages they are going to, and how they found the site. This details can assist businesses to understand which marketing efforts are most efficient and to target their sales efforts better.
In addition to its lead capture and management tool, Leadfeeder likewise offers combinations with other sales and marketing tools, such as client relationship management (CRM) systems and e-mail marketing platforms. This permits companies to easily move and track leads as they move through the sales procedure.
Overall, Leadfeeder intends to help companies generate more qualified leads and enhance their sales and marketing efforts.
Another fantastic feature that I enjoy about Leadfeeder is its automatic lead scoring. It instantly places the hottest and the most pertinent leads on top so that you don’t miss out on the chance to transform them.
Leadfeeder scores the leads based upon the number of visits, pages viewed, bounces, and last see date. It ratings leads out of 10– the higher a lead scores, the greater it ranks.

Another benefit of lead feeders is that they can help companies to sector and arrange their leads based on numerous criteria. This can consist of elements such as market, company size, area, and other qualities. By arranging leads in this way, businesses can tailor their sales and marketing efforts more effectively and target the right leads with the right message.
Lead feeders can also assist companies to track the development of their leads through the sales procedure. By offering a clear view of where each lead is in the process, businesses can make sure that they are acting on leads in a prompt way and not letting any opportunities slip through the fractures.
